Hey all,
last night i had my last straw with my 2 Maxijet 1200's... they constantly fall off the glass and stir up the tank... so i took them out and want to replace them.

i have a 60 gallon cube and would like something reliable with a magnet back. i keep 3 BTA's and would like good flow, small risk to the nems (i'll get a cover if need be) and a small footprint

thanks in advance
 
I have two jebao rw4s in my 60g cube and I really like them. They're small but powerful and economical.
 
There are 2 different ways I would go.
My first preference would be with a pair of VorTech MP10QD's.
My second would be a pair of Tunze 6055's with a Tunze controller.

Both expensive, but both are quality equipment and very quiet.
 
I would reccomend an mp40. While they are expensive and I was hesitant at making the purchase at first it was honestly the best investment I made. I love it. Also +1 on the two mp10
